Uploaded image for project: 'Core ReactOS'
  1. Core ReactOS
  2. CORE-17595

Regression, VBox 4.3.12 guest additions can not longer be installed in safe mode "Failed to calculate strong name"

    XMLWordPrintable

    Details

    • Type: Bug
    • Status: Resolved
    • Priority: Blocker
    • Resolution: Fixed
    • Fix Version/s: 0.4.15
    • Component/s: NTCore
    • Labels:
    • Module:
    • Guilty Commit:
      0.4.15-dev-xxxx (some MM commit)

      Description

      I tested 0.4.15-dev-2569-g9f549db gcc 8.4.0 dbg win.
      This test has been done on a computer without VT-x extensions.

      Reproduction steps

      • use VirtualBox 4.3.12, other versions might reproduce the issue as well, but 4.3.12 is what I tested
      • (VBox 5.1.x and 6.0.x do still offer that feature)
      • DO NOT USE VBOX 6.1 TO TEST AS IT LACKS THAT FEATURE 3D GRAPHICS
      • Enable 3D support in graphics settings
      • Install ROS
      • After graphical setup, boot to safe mode and install VBox Additions with "Direct3D" support enabled.

      Expected result
      The setup should complete
      The last time that my notes proved me performing that sequence successfully was with:
      0.4.14-RC-36-gb30846a (gcc4.7.2 win) and
      0.4.15-dev-730-gabbe656 (built gcc win, but I don't remember the version)
      reactos-bootcd-0.4.15-dev-2069-gfd8080b-x86-gcc-lin-dbg_STILL_OK.webm

      Observed result
      The setup fails and the screenshot shows something about "Failed to calculate strong name"
      0.4.15-dev-2569-g9f549db_guestAdditionsFailed.png
      0.4.15-dev-2569-g9f549db_guestAdditionsFailed.log

      The bugs reproducibility is not 100%, it happens maybe on 33% of the tries for me for the affected builds! May be a race condition.

        Attachments

        1. 0.4.15-dev-2569-g9f549db_guestAdditionsFailed.log
          32 kB
        2. 0.4.15-dev-2569-g9f549db_guestAdditionsFailed.png
          0.4.15-dev-2569-g9f549db_guestAdditionsFailed.png
          34 kB
        3. 0.4.15-dev-2591-g831cad3_sledgehammer_revert_additions_ok.webm
          1.12 MB
        4. 0.4.15-dev-2599-gb0ebf68_JID59534_zefklop_and_DebugChannel_crypt_and_cryptnet__the_setup_did_succeed_unexpectedly.log
          154 kB
        5. 0.4.15-dev-2599-gb0ebf68_JID59534_zefklop_and_DebugChannel_crypt_and_cryptnet__theLastAttempt_strongName_andFuncNames.log
          192 kB
        6. 0.4.15-dev-2599-gb0ebf68_JID59534_zefklop_and_DebugChannel_crypt_and_cryptnet__theLastAttemptRanIntoTheStrongNameIssue.log
          187 kB
        7. 0.4.15-dev-2599-gb0ebf68_JID59534_zefklop_and_DebugChannel_crypt_cryptnet_cryptasn__theLastAttempt_strongName_debugformatExt.log
          708 kB
        8. 0.4.15-dev-2664-g4db8b82_fullOutputFromTheGuestAdditionsInstallerWindow.txt
          3 kB
        9. 0.4.15-dev-2721-g5912c11_part2_threadSani_tonsOfAssertionsDuring3rdStageBootup.log
          140 kB
        10. 0.4.15-dev-2721-g5912c11_part2_threadSani_tonsOfAssertionsDuring3rdStageBootup.png
          0.4.15-dev-2721-g5912c11_part2_threadSani_tonsOfAssertionsDuring3rdStageBootup.png
          15 kB
        11. 0.4.15-dev-2721-g5912c11_part3_threadSani_7xVBoxAdditionsSetup_noAsserts_and_no_strongNameBug.log
          162 kB
        12. 0.4.15-dev-2721-g5912c11_threadSanitize_tonsOfAssertions_FinallyABSOD.log
          120 kB
        13. 0.4.15-dev-2790-ge8277e5_patchedPR3748_2021-06-26Commit_25d9cee__became_0.4.15-dev-2791-g00e13a2_stillAffected.log
          127 kB
        14. 0.4.15-dev-3720-g4cf9b79_PR4302_patched_gotItOn2ndTry.log
          107 kB
        15. 0.4.15-dev-3720-g4cf9b79_PR4302_patched_gotItOn2ndTry.png
          0.4.15-dev-3720-g4cf9b79_PR4302_patched_gotItOn2ndTry.png
          46 kB
        16. a_few_more_assertions_did_happen_afterwards_when_i_just_left_the_OS_idling__netshell_ornetwork_related.log
          197 kB
        17. CORE-17585-set-dirty-bit.diff
          3 kB
        18. CORE-17587-complete-2.diff
          5 kB
        19. CORE-17595_06.patch
          2 kB
        20. CORE-17595_Fail_01.png
          CORE-17595_Fail_01.png
          109 kB
        21. CORE-17595_Fail_02.png
          CORE-17595_Fail_02.png
          97 kB
        22. CORE-17595_Fail_03.png
          CORE-17595_Fail_03.png
          96 kB
        23. CORE-17595-07.patch
          9 kB
        24. crypt-test.patch
          0.4 kB
        25. ForDougItFailedOnFirstTryAlready_safeMode.png
          ForDougItFailedOnFirstTryAlready_safeMode.png
          275 kB
        26. invlpg_always.diff
          0.5 kB
        27. invlpg_eax.diff
          0.5 kB
        28. JID59547_strongName_at3rdTry.log
          1.07 MB
        29. JID59551_complete2__crypt_cryptnet_cryptasn_wintrust_strongName_on1stTry.log
          135 kB
        30. JID59551_complete2__crypt_cryptnet_cryptasn_wintrust_strongName_on1stTry.png
          JID59551_complete2__crypt_cryptnet_cryptasn_wintrust_strongName_on1stTry.png
          40 kB
        31. JID59551_complete2_strongNameBug_on4thTry.log
          1.45 MB
        32. JID59551_complete2_strongNameBug_on4thTry.png
          JID59551_complete2_strongNameBug_on4thTry.png
          43 kB
        33. PatchDoesNotApply.png
          PatchDoesNotApply.png
          10 kB
        34. PR3798_stillStrongName.png
          PR3798_stillStrongName.png
          45 kB
        35. reactos-bootcd-0.4.15-dev-2069-gfd8080b-x86-gcc-lin-dbg_STILL_OK.webm
          869 kB
        36. stack_unstack.diff
          0.9 kB
        37. Strong_Name_Error_15_3326.png
          Strong_Name_Error_15_3326.png
          97 kB
        38. Strong_Name_Error_8_10_Fail.png
          Strong_Name_Error_8_10_Fail.png
          93 kB
        39. thread_sanitization.diff
          54 kB
        40. Using_legacy_mode_for_install_good.png
          Using_legacy_mode_for_install_good.png
          229 kB
        41. Using_legacy_mode_for_install.png
          Using_legacy_mode_for_install.png
          118 kB
        42. VBoxWindowsAdditions-x86_4_3_12.exe
          9.99 MB
        43. VirtualBox_ReactOS_06_09_2022_20_25_43.png
          VirtualBox_ReactOS_06_09_2022_20_25_43.png
          53 kB

          Issue Links

            Activity

              People

              • Assignee:
                zefklop jgardou
                Reporter:
                reactosfanboy reactosfanboy
              • Votes:
                4 Vote for this issue
                Watchers:
                5 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ved: